Plot

Toby is a heartwarming and entertaining portrait of one of the last travelling variety shows in the United States. Every summer, Toby, the troupe's charming, down-to-earth owner/lead actor takes his small band of performers to towns across the Midwest to perform under a massive tent. Leacock captures the heat of the summer night on the faces of the appreciative audiences, the thrill of the live performances and the challenge of the set-up.
